Every child deserves a chance to dream big, and for many, that dream is made possible through the incredible work of Make-A-Wish. Make-A-Wish is a global organization that grants wishes to children with critical illnesses, providing them with hope, strength, and joy during their most challenging times. These young individuals, known as “Make-A-Wish Kids,” have the opportunity to turn their wishes into reality, creating memories that will last a lifetime.

Wishes come in all shapes and sizes, from meeting a beloved celebrity to embarking on an adventurous trip, or even having a dream bedroom transformed into a magical wonderland. The impact of these wishes is profound, as they not only bring happiness to the children but also to their families and communities.
